Description

This book explores the complex questions facing funding agencies and foundations as they grapple to understand and define gender equity in education. As a collection of writings, many of which are written by the foundations themselves, the book engages the reader in the different approaches funders use to define gender equity, target limited resources, and create collaborative relationships that will ultimately make schools more equitable and engaging for boys and girls of a variety of cultural backgrounds.
